把 Antigravity 打包进 Docker,部署到海外服务器,彻底解决网络问题
最近在用 Antigravity ,本地用着挺好,但每次都要挂梯子,而且 AI 补全延迟明显。干脆写了个 Docker 镜像,把 Antigravity 跑在海外 VPS
上,通过浏览器直接访问,网络问题一次性解决。
项目地址: https://github.com/runzhliu/docker-antigravity
核心思路
- 基于 linuxserver/chrome ,内置 Selkies-GStreamer ,把桌面通过 WebRTC 串流到浏览器
- Antigravity 跑在容器里,AI 请求直接走服务器出口,不依赖本地网络
- 打开浏览器就能用,不需要在本地装任何东西
一条命令启动
docker run -d \
--name=antigravity \
-e CUSTOM_USER=your-username \
-e PASSWORD=your-password \
-p 3000:3000 \
-v ./config:/config \
--shm-size="1gb" \
ghcr.io/runzhliu/docker-antigravity:latest
浏览器打开 http://your-server-ip:3000 即可。
适合场景
- 有海外 VPS 但不想在每台机器上折腾本地环境的
- 多设备共享同一个 Antigravity 实例
- 网络受限环境下使用 AI 编程工具
有问题欢迎 issue 或直接回帖。